1. Networking and Building Connections
One of the primary benefits of being part of an IT community is the opportunity to network and build meaningful connections. Networking is a powerful tool for career growth, as it allows professionals to exchange ideas, seek advice, and learn from each other's experiences. In a community, IT pros can connect with peers, mentors, and industry leaders who can offer valuable insights and guidance. These connections can open doors to new opportunities, collaborations, and even job offers.
1.1 Expanding Professional Horizons
Being part of a community exposes IT professionals to diverse perspectives and expertise. This exposure helps them broaden their knowledge base and stay updated with the latest industry trends and technologies. By interacting with a wide range of professionals, IT pros can gain insights into different areas of the industry, which can be instrumental in their career development.
1.2 Access to Hidden Opportunities
Many job openings and career opportunities are not advertised publicly but are instead shared within professional networks. By being active in an IT community, professionals can gain access to these hidden opportunities. Additionally, personal recommendations and referrals from community members can significantly enhance one's chances of securing desirable positions.
2. Learning and Skill Development
The IT industry is characterized by constant change and innovation. To stay relevant and competitive, IT professionals must continuously learn and develop new skills. Communities play a crucial role in facilitating this ongoing education.
2.1 Knowledge Sharing and Collaboration
Within a community, IT pros can share their knowledge and expertise with each other. This collaborative environment fosters continuous learning and skill development. Community events such as workshops, webinars, and conferences provide platforms for professionals to learn from industry experts and peers. These events often cover a wide range of topics, from the latest technological advancements to best practices and troubleshooting techniques.
2.2 Mentorship and Support
Mentorship is a vital aspect of professional growth. Experienced members of an IT community can offer mentorship and support to those who are newer to the field. This guidance can help less experienced professionals navigate the complexities of their careers, set goals, and develop strategies for achieving them. Mentorship relationships built within a community can be long-lasting and profoundly impactful.
3. Professional Visibility and Reputation
Building a strong professional reputation is essential for career advancement. Being an active and contributing member of an IT community can significantly enhance an individual's visibility and reputation within the industry.
3.1 Showcasing Expertise
Active participation in community activities, such as speaking at events, writing articles, or contributing to discussions, allows IT professionals to showcase their expertise. This visibility not only establishes them as thought leaders but also builds credibility and trust among peers and potential employers.
3.2 Building a Personal Brand
In today's digital age, personal branding is more important than ever. IT professionals can leverage community platforms, such as social media groups, forums, and online communities, to build and promote their personal brand. By consistently sharing valuable content and engaging with others, they can establish themselves as knowledgeable and influential figures in their field.
4. Emotional and Psychological Support
The demands of the IT industry can be stressful and challenging. Having a supportive community can provide emotional and psychological benefits that contribute to overall well-being and career satisfaction.
4.1 Overcoming Isolation
IT professionals, especially those working remotely or in specialized roles, can often feel isolated. Being part of a community helps combat this isolation by providing a sense of belonging and camaraderie. Knowing that there are others who share similar experiences and challenges can be reassuring and motivating.
4.2 Encouragement and Motivation
Communities offer a space for IT pros to celebrate their successes and seek encouragement during difficult times. Positive reinforcement and motivation from peers can boost confidence and help professionals stay focused on their goals. The shared experiences within a community can also provide valuable lessons and inspiration.
5. Collaboration and Innovation
The IT industry thrives on innovation, and collaboration is a key driver of creative solutions and advancements. Communities provide the perfect breeding ground for collaborative efforts.
5.1 Cross-Disciplinary Collaboration
Within an IT community, professionals from various disciplines come together to share their expertise and work on projects. This cross-disciplinary collaboration fosters innovative thinking and the development of cutting-edge solutions. By leveraging the diverse skill sets of community members, IT pros can tackle complex challenges more effectively.
5.2 Incubating New Ideas
Communities often serve as incubators for new ideas and initiatives. Brainstorming sessions, hackathons, and collaborative projects allow IT professionals to experiment with new concepts and technologies. These collaborative endeavors can lead to the creation of groundbreaking products and services.
